IIT Madras Research Park & RBI’s innovation centre Collaborates

Published on June 02, 2023
Current Context: A collaboration between Reserve Bank Innovation Hub (RBIH), IIT Madras Research Park (IITMRP) and IIT Madras Incubation Cell (IITMIC) to introduce voice-banking solutions to eliminate language barriers across the country.
IIT Madras Research Park & RBI’s innovation centre Collaborates
  • The voice-based banking solution aims at performing basic banking transactions through voice-commands in the Indian languages of Hindi, Tamil and Telugu to start with, in addition to English.
  • The innovation will assist people who are illiterate and visually impaired, in their banking services and help the underbanked population in overcoming language barriers during their banking activities.
  • The project is expected to roll out a pilot in around 12-18 months and potentially scale them in the next 2-3 year.
